About Connie Health

Connie Health is a fast-growing Medicare brokerage on a mission to empower older Americans to make confident, worry-free Medicare plan decisions. We offer a tech-enabled Medicare navigation platform that combines an AI-driven technology with local Medicare experts to help people select optimal healthcare plans and navigate their benefits. Our culture is mission-driven, collaborative, and innovative, as we strive to transform healthcare through data-driven insights and personalized guidance. We value Relationships First, Data-Driven Decision Making, and being Accountable in delivering unbiased, high-quality advice to our customers.

Role Overview

Connie Health is looking for a detail-oriented Data Operations Analyst who thrives at the intersection of technical analysis and business execution. This is an operations-heavy role focused on the integrity, synchronization, and optimization of our core business data. You will be tasked with bridging the gap between our internal systems by identifying friction points, investigating complex data discrepancies, and implementing the logic that powers our growth and financial accuracy. In this role, you won't just be looking at dashboards; you will be the steward of our data ecosystem, ensuring that information flows seamlessly across the organization and that our records remain a "single source of truth." The ideal candidate enjoys "data detective" work—diving deep into discrepancies to find root causes and building the systems to ensure they don’t happen again.

This is a hybrid role, based out of our Boston office near South Station.

What You’ll Do

  • Own the daily resolution of data syncing issues between our core business platforms, data feeds from third party systems, and our CRM.
  • Perform in-depth investigations into unexpected data behavior, resolving immediate issues while partnering with the Sales Operations and Engineering teams to implement systemic preventions.
  • Operate and iteratively improve existing exception reporting frameworks to reduce manual overhead and increase data reliability.
  • Partner closely with the Finance team to prepare and clean large datasets to assist in the assessment of M&A opportunities, and execute customer and policy data imports following successful business acquisitions.
  • Document data flows and standard operating procedures for the data lifecycle at Connie Health.
